How to Get the Most Out of Step-by-Step Solutions eHelp Resources
Here are some tips for getting the most out of step-by-step solutions eHelp resources:
- Actively engage with the material. Don’t just passively read the solutions. Try to understand each step and why it is necessary. Take notes and ask yourself questions.
- Try the problems yourself before looking at the solutions. This will help you to identify the areas where you need help. If you get stuck, look at the solution to see how to solve the problem. Then, try the problem again on your own.
- Use the solutions to learn from your mistakes. When you look at a solution, identify the steps that you were able to do on your own and the steps that you needed help with. Focus on learning from the steps that you needed help with.
- Don’t rely on eHelp resources too much. While eHelp resources can be helpful, it’s important to be able to solve problems on your own. Don’t just rely on eHelp resources to do your homework for you.
